Enhancing Customer Experience Through Proactive Support

Proactive computer support involves anticipating potential issues and addressing them before they impact the customer. This approach can significantly enhance the customer experience by reducing the likelihood of disruptions and ensuring smooth operations. For instance, regular system maintenance and updates can prevent security vulnerabilities and performance issues. Monitoring tools can detect anomalies and alert support teams to potential problems, allowing for preemptive action. By taking a proactive stance, businesses can demonstrate their commitment to reliability and customer care, leading to higher satisfaction levels. Customers appreciate when their service providers are one step ahead, ensuring a seamless and trouble-free experience.

Leveraging Technology for Improved Support

Advancements in technology have opened up new avenues for enhancing the efficiency and effectiveness of computer support. Artificial intelligence (AI) and machine learning algorithms can analyze vast amounts of data to identify patterns and predict potential issues. Chatbots and virtual assistants can provide instant support for common queries, freeing up human agents to handle more complex problems. Remote support tools enable technicians to access and troubleshoot systems from anywhere, reducing the need for on-site visits. These technologies not only improve response times but also enhance the accuracy and reliability of support services. By leveraging these tools, businesses can provide a higher level of support that meets the evolving needs of their customers.

Measuring the Impact of Computer Support on Customer Satisfaction

To understand the impact of computer support on customer satisfaction, businesses need to employ a range of metrics and methods. Customer satisfaction surveys can provide direct feedback on the support experience, highlighting areas of strength and opportunities for improvement. Key performance indicators (KPIs) such as first response time, resolution time, and customer effort score can offer quantitative insights into the efficiency and effectiveness of support services. Additionally, tracking repeat support requests and analyzing customer retention rates can reveal the long-term impact of support on customer loyalty. By systematically measuring these factors, businesses can gain a comprehensive understanding of how their support services influence customer satisfaction and make data-driven improvements.
